Lämpönsiirtokerrokset refer to layers that facilitate or impede the transfer of heat. In building insulation, these layers are crucial for controlling the flow of thermal energy, thus influencing a building's energy efficiency and occupant comfort. Different materials possess varying thermal properties, affecting their effectiveness as heat transfer layers. For instance, materials with low thermal conductivity, such as fiberglass or foam, act as insulators, slowing down heat transfer. Conversely, materials with high thermal conductivity, like metals, readily transfer heat.
